Definition of The Real conditionals:

These conditionals describe habitual or factual conditions which have the probability to happen in the future or generally happen in the present.

Examples of The Real conditionals:

  • If I have time, I will attend the program.
  • If you come early, you will be able to meet Tom.
  • If Jack comes here, he will fix the fan.
  • If Aric drives in such a stormy weather, he may have an accident.
  • If you are going out in this rain, you must take an umbrella with you.
  • If I get time, I meet with my relatives.
  • If you win the bet, Jeff will give you a treat in the most expensive restaurant.
  • If Alice comes here, she meets me.
  • If you work hard, you will be able to complete the project on time.
  • If Albert has leisure time, he goes to the library.
  • If you go out in such heavy rain, you will get wet.
  • Please attend the program if you have time.
  • Please come to my place if you are coming to this part of the city.
  • If you have the responsibility, perform it properly.
  • If you say this to Rick, he will become angry.
  • Please help Richard if you can.
  • I will call you if I get an update.
  • If you come at the mentioned time, you will not miss the flight.
  • If you are going to Alana’s place, please give this gift to her.
  • If you are going to the bank, please collect your debit card.
